1913 Liberty Head Nickel
The 1913 Liberty Head Nickel is one of the most famous coins in American numismatics. Only five examples are known to exist, and their mysterious origin adds intrigue. Each surviving coin has sold for millions, making it one of the most valuable nickels ever struck.

1937-D Three-Legged Buffalo Nickel
This coin is famous for its minting error, where one of the buffalo’s legs appears missing due to over-polishing of the die. The error created a distinctive design that collectors find fascinating. Well-preserved examples are valued in the millions.
